I am knitting a hat from the crown to the rim on circular needles, and want to know the technique for "binding off" while on circular needles. I cannot find any video demonstrating this method. Does anyone know of any links to a video, or easy to follow verbal directions?

Bind off like you normally would, the BO is only passing one stitch over the other. When you do the last stitch though, it can be higher than the first stitch bound off because you actually knit a spiral. I pick up a stitch from the center of the first bound off stitch (not the top edge) and pass the last loop over that, then pull the tail through and pull it to the WS to weave in. Doing the extra stitch pulls down the last bound off stitch and it blends in very well with the rest of the edge.
